Yajl Template implementation
Yajl is a fast JSON parsing and encoding library for Ruby See github.com/brianmario/yajl-ruby
The template source is evaluated as a Ruby string, and the result is converted to_json.
# This is a template example. # The template can contain any Ruby statement. tpl <<-EOS @counter = 0 # The json variable represents the buffer # and holds the data to be serialized into json. # It defaults to an empty hash, but you can override it at any time. json = { :"user#{@counter += 1}" => { :name => "Joshua Peek", :id => @counter }, :"user#{@counter += 1}" => { :name => "Ryan Tomayko", :id => @counter }, :"user#{@counter += 1}" => { :name => "Simone Carletti", :id => @counter }, } # Since the json variable is a Hash, # you can use conditional statements or any other Ruby statement # to populate it. json[:"user#{@counter += 1}"] = { :name => "Unknown" } if 1 == 2 # The last line doesn't affect the returned value. nil EOS template = Tilt::YajlTemplate.new { tpl } template.render(self)
Decorates the json input according to given options.
json - The json String to decorate. options - The option Hash to customize the behavior.
Returns the decorated String.
# File lib/tilt/yajl.rb, line 80 80: def decorate(json) 81: callback, variable = options[:callback], options[:variable] 82: if callback && variable 83: "var #{variable} = #{json}; #{callback}(#{variable});" 84: elsif variable 85: "var #{variable} = #{json};" 86: elsif callback 87: "#{callback}(#{json});" 88: else 89: json 90: end 91: end
